Enhancing Women’s Participation in Electoral Processes in Post-conflict Countries

Women without Borders (WwB) Founder and Executive Director Dr. Edit Schlaffer participates in the Office of the Special Advisor on Gender Issues and Advancement of Women in the Department of Economic and Social Affairs (OSAGI DESA) expert group meeting on ‘Enhancing women’s participation in electoral processes in post-conflict countries’ at the Harrison Conference Center in Glen Cove, NY. The group discusses electoral processes in post-conflict countries and the obstacles, lessons learned, and good practices in enhancing women’s participation in these processes.
